What if your hands held the blueprint to your emotions, your relationships — even your health?

In this mind-opening episode, Kari sits down with Lisa Greenfield, intuitive coach and hand analyst, to reveal the very real connections between your palm lines and your personal wiring. Forget the fortune-teller clichés — this is palmistry like you’ve never heard it before: smart, soulful, and deeply validating.

You’ll learn:

  • Why your heart line reveals how you give and receive love
  • What your finger spacing says about your trust style
  • How your “mouse” muscle shows immune strength and burnout
  • Why your hands change as you grow — and how to work with that

Lisa explains how palmistry connects to astrology, brain function, and emotional patterns — and why your hand lines are living maps that shift as you do.

✨ Plus: Kari and Lisa talk rogue pinkies, curved lines, and how to tell if you're here for the long haul or just along for the ride.
